Tabs in the background grab the focus away from front tab

User-Agent: Mozilla/5.0 (Windows; U; Windows NT 5.1; en-US; rv:1.6) Gecko/20040113 Build Identifier: Mozilla/5.0 (Windows; U; Windows NT 5.1; en-US; rv:1.6) Gecko/20040113 When I go to a group of tabs, if an html page in one of the background tabs requests the keyboard focus it is given to it (it shouldn't), and this causes the user to (1) lose focus on the first "front" tab while typing something, and (2) make the background tab (which you cannot see) accept all the user input (keystrokes and cursor scrolling. Reproducible: Always Steps to Reproduce: 1. Bookmark a group of tabs (yahoo mail, new york times and slashdot for example). 2. Go to that group of tabs and start typing. Actual Results: The focus does not remain on your yahoo mail but rather on the new york times tab in the back. Expected Results: Not allow background tabs to grab the keyboard focus.
